Hello Patrick I have a 2005 Mustang Gt with Maunual transmission. I was driving on the freeway and downshifted into 3rd gear while releasing the clutch, the pedal went completely loose I had to coast to the side of the road because I was unable to-engage the clutch to put it in gear. I turned the car off and started it but it then died I tried starting it again and it was running weird but It turned it of. I then I noticed was leaking a good amount fluid from were the transmission meets the fly wheel area.I couldn't tell what the fluid was but it was not red in color, but more clear with a slightly burnt sweet smell. My car then eventually started to loose battery power and eventually died. When the tow truck driver dropped me off we used a car charger to power my car and my vehicle on my dash read CHECK BRAKE SYSTEM and also CHECK CHARGING SYSTEM. Im just curious what you think could be the issue, Is it something to do with the master or slave cylinder or is it possibly a blown engine

My car has 104000 miles.
My car has a manual transmission.
